Transaction 03c937d3485d07df6c6eb300da5db424a898d5d3ec66b7f0e7efd5067b47882a
1 Input
1 Output
-
03c937d3485d07df6c6eb300da5db424a898d5d3ec66b7f0e7efd5067b47882a:0
- value
- 532561
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f68b291d65be25a73e265ee906f0cd5501e5e30 OP_EQUAL
- address
- 3EmHyVFkhy3CvnVh1iShHCunzchpu2aEdr